Section 47: Receipt of department reports by farmers' clubs; annual returns; reports

Section 47. Farmers' clubs which are organized and are holding regular meetings shall, upon application made annually in November to the commissioner, receive copies of the department's report and of its other publications, in proportion to the number of their members and to the applications so made. A club which receives such copies shall annually in October make returns to said commissioner of its agricultural experiments and of the reports of its committees.
